What is four-point bend testing?
Four-point bend testing determines a material’s flexural strength and stiffness by applying force at two points between two supports.

Applicators and dispensers
Applicators and dispensers are designed to provide uniform coverage of semi-solids, liquids and viscous matter such as creams and lotions. They are often integrated with the product's packaging so that the packaging also acts as a dispenser.

Understanding compressive deformation
Compressive deformation is the change in shape or size of a material when it is subjected to compressive forces. This can involve a reduction in length, thickness, or volume when an object is pressed or squeezed.
